Learn about plants, animals, and minerals at GALERIES, JARDINS, ZOO, the country's main botanical garden and the headquarters of the National Museum of Natural History. Founded in 1626, this nature retreat in the center of Paris features four museums--on zoology, mineralogy, paleontology, and botany--as well as a small zoo and the world's largest herbarium, all nestled on the left bank of the Seine. As you stroll leisurely around the spacious French-style garden, notice how hundred varieties of plants take turns to maintain this living horticultural catalog. Don't miss the serene alpine garden and its oldest resident--315-year-old pistachio tree.
